The Black and the Black: Lesson Two
by
Adam Gosha
Blank page, the brain's a torture
devise, devine! Blank stare, unlike other
days piercing grey eyes.
Are you willing, or comfortable
with drinking another glass of my pouring
hearts blood? Emotions again fill
me drowning, my lungs
can't breathe but love-seasoned
oxygen. Memories of love's fatal wounds:
the other side, looking in, then
looking away, and in me still staring while I
sink below conscienceness.
